How to Discover Free CNA Training Programs in Boston MA
Finding free CNA training in Boston involves exploring multiple resources and understanding eligibility requirements. Here are the primary avenues to locate these programs:
1. Local Community Colleges and Technical Schools
Many community colleges in Boston offer subsidized or free CNA training programs, especially through partnerships with local healthcare providers or government initiatives. Examples include:
- Boston Adult Learning Programs
- City of Boston Workforce Advancement initiatives
- Partnerships with non-profit organizations and hospitals
2. State and Federal Assistance Programs
Massachusetts offers various grants and assistance programs supporting healthcare training. Key programs include:
- Massachusetts Workforce training Fund: Funds for unemployed or underemployed individuals seeking CNA certification
- Massachusetts Rehabilitation Commission: Supports individuals with disabilities to access free training
3.Healthcare Employer Sponsorships
Some hospitals and long-term care facilities in Boston sponsor CNA training programs as part of their workforce development efforts. These programs frequently enough offer free training coupled with employment upon certification.
4. Non-Profit and Community Organizations
Organizations such as Boston Health Care for the Homeless Program and Greater Boston Legal Service sometimes provide free CNA training as part of community outreach initiatives.

Steps to Enroll in Free CNA Training Programs in Boston
- Research Eligible Programs: Utilize the sources listed above to identify programs available to you.
- meet Eligibility Criteria: Typically, candidates should be at least 18 years old, have a high school diploma or GED, and pass a background check.
- Prepare Necessary Documents: Gather IDs, transcripts, and any required forms.
- Apply and Submit Applications: Follow application instructions carefully and meet deadlines.
- Complete orientation and Training: Engage fully in coursework, clinical practice, and certification exam planning.
